The CheckLoom platform loads third-party validator plugins through the Spindle registry API. Each plugin declares its schema targets, severity mappings, and sandbox tier in a signed manifest; Spindle rejects manifests lacking a sandbox declaration. Registration calls are idempotent, keyed on the plugin's content hash, so re-submitting an unchanged manifest is safe. All registry writes require an authenticated session scoped to `plugin:publish`. For the demo during the sync, authenticate against the staging registry with the key below.

app token of tagef-tafog = qvz3-7n0

OFF-SITE RUN CHECKLIST — Item 7: Sealed-bid tender delivery

- Collect the sealed tender envelope for the Rothmere depot contract from the locked drawer in the office manager's room.
- Verify the wax seal is intact and the submission reference is written on the outer sleeve only.
- Do not photocopy or open the envelope under any circumstances.
- Book the afternoon courier and brief them using the hand-over instruction below.

dispatch memo: the lamwyn fenwyn courier leaves the wenir ledger at gate 7175 under passcode 822969

## Step 4 — Sign the scanner build

Before deploying Squatwatch, the typo-squatting package scanner, sign the release bundle produced in step 3. Unsigned bundles are rejected by the Ferrodome gateway. New team members: confirm the build digest matches the CI summary first, then sign and upload. The signing key currently in use is shown below.

rollout seal: bky4_x7Gc

## Ownership

Ratewick checks rate parity across the Lantern Hotels booking channels. Core logic lives in parity/engine; scrapers are in parity/collectors and are the usual source of breakage. Reviewers: any change touching comparison thresholds needs a second approval. Tests must pass against the fixtures in testdata/channels. Final sign-off on parity-engine changes belongs to the maintainer named below.

named custodian: Brivan Eliath Quenox Frador